  Published: 2013-05-24, Author: Mike , review by: pocket-lint.com

  • Affordable compared to rivals, small body but big and varied zoom range, image stabilisation, full vari-angle LCD, low ISO shots bright and colourful
  • Tricky to shoot at 1000mm because of feature restraints, autofocus at longer focal lengths is a little slow, no raw, image quality not pushing forward
  • All things considered and the P520 is, in general, a decent superzoom camera. We like the small size, big zoom range, image stabilisation and new vari-angle screen - but even all that's just not enough to see it prevail as a class leader. And that'...

  Published: 2013-11-01, review by: cameralabs.com

  • Capable 42x optical zoom range, Big, detailed 3.2 in articulated screen, Excellent VR optical stabilisation, Built-in GPS with POI database.
  • Slow handling and writing to card, Poor battery life, No built-in Wifi, No hot shoe, No RAW mode.
  • The Nikon COOLPIX P520 has a lot to offer. Its 42x zoom lens is one of the longest optical zooms around and combined with the excellent Vibration Reduction optical stabilisation produces great results. It has a bigger, more detailed screen than most a...
